    The database is only equipped to handle 'male', 'female', or ''. If we ever wanted to upgrade the board software (which we probably should at some point for security reasons alone), changing that now would possibly break the upgrade process, especially if newer versions have other options for that column. The signup form template is possible to edit. I imagine the user profile template is as well.
